Transaction 858820d6a716181d0397dd95b614bd75c7f9c4ea7978f7d1ff5a4e9d38207e61

1 Input
2 Outputs
  • 858820d6a716181d0397dd95b614bd75c7f9c4ea7978f7d1ff5a4e9d38207e61:0
  • value  9810988
    address  1H1Uc1SUNwVsF7BzjbeAELwdBqwfwqN56c
  • 858820d6a716181d0397dd95b614bd75c7f9c4ea7978f7d1ff5a4e9d38207e61:1
  • value  34833994
    address  1EUW9e69GjJouugsNT8GsQejVfb1gdLwHB